Not A Healthy Idea (Nassau County)
ECO's Joseph Munn, Aaron Gordon and MEU ECO Sean Reilly were on boat patrol on 12 October 2008,
patrolling the Long Island Sound. As they approached a boat off of Lloyd Point, they noticed the fishermen on
board had a striped bass which they were about to throw back in the water. The fishermen were asked if they
had any other fish; they replied that they had some bluefish. Officer Gordon boarded the boat and found five
short striped bass in a large cooler in the bow of the boat.

When the illegal fish were found, one of the menspoke up and said, "You got us.? The officers asked the fishermen why they had the fish when they knew they
were too short. They both replied, "Well, our doctors both told us to have more fish in our diets.? ECATs were
issued to each of the men for possession of undersize and over-the-limit striped bass.
